Chapter 1. Philippine Cuisine -- 2. History of the Philippines & Its Food: A Timeline -- 3. Native Ingredients -- 4. Luzon Cuisine -- 5. Mindanao Cuisine -- 6. Mindanao Cuisine -- 7. Cooking Methods -- 8. Philippine Condiments -- References.
The Philippines is a country with beautiful nature and delicious foods. It is a land of diversity, in which history and present mix, offering a great variety of cultures, languages and foods.
